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To form a V-shaped portion of a Y-shaped soundproof wall on the upper end side thereof into a unit so that the wall can be attached to a main wall easily and rapidly. SOLUTION: The soundproof units 1 are mounted parallelly on the upper end of a main wall formed by providing wall panels between supports disposed at a predetermined interval. In this case, a first and second branch walls 2, 3 which are inclined toward the side of a sound source and toward the opposite side of the sound source, respectively, are provided and a standing wall 4 which rises from the inner surfaces of the walls 2, 3 and extends from the side of the sound source to the opposite side of the sound side to interconnect both the walls 2, 3 is provided and further a plurality of connection pipes 5-7 are provided on the walls 2, 3 in the longitudinal direction of the main wall.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a soundproof unit used for a soundproof wall provided as a measure for preventing noise generated by roads, railways, factories and the like.

Description of the Related Art Conventionally, as a measure for preventing noise generated by roads, railways, factories, and the like, installation of a soundproof wall has been widely adopted to prevent noise from directly transmitting from a noise source. ing. This is because sound barriers are relatively inexpensive in various noise prevention measures, and are effective for various noise sources. In order to increase the noise reduction effect, it is necessary to increase the height of the soundproof wall. However, raising the noise barrier increases costs (the higher the height, the higher the construction costs,
It will increase the cost). In addition, there are many problems such as sunshine, landscape, view, feeling of oppression, ventilation, radio interference, wind load resistance, and the like.

Further, if the noise reduction effect is not sufficient with the straight wall alone, the front end of the soundproof wall or the front end of the soundproof wall formed by bending the front end of the soundproof wall toward the noise source side in a shape of "<" is used. There are curved soundproof walls that are curved on the noise source side, but these have more problems than landscape walls, such as landscape, view, oppression, ventilation, radio interference, wind resistance, and the like. Recently, with the increase in traffic volume and the speed of vehicles, the environmental noise problem has become serious, and there is no other countermeasure. Therefore, at the expense of the above problems, 3m, 7m, and 10m straight wall soundproofing. Walls, and even break-through soundproof walls,
Curved soundproof walls are used.

However, even if these soundproof walls are used, they can only be expected to have an effect corresponding to the height of the soundproof walls. In general, at a distant position (at a distance of about 20 m from the soundproof wall), the noise reduction effect obtained by increasing the height of the soundproof wall by 1 m is about 1 dB.

In order to increase the noise reduction effect without increasing the height of the sound-insulating wall, a Y-type sound-insulating wall as a whole has been developed by inclining the upper end side to the sound source side and the opposite sound source side. Was done. In the construction of the inclined wall on the upper end side of the Y-type soundproof wall, a frame was formed using a steel frame or the like, and a wall panel was attached to the frame.

The assembling of the branch wall on the upper end side of the Y-type soundproof wall is not only a work at a high place, but also requires a slope, so that it is difficult to construct the branch wall. I couldn't shorten it either.

As is clear from Table 1, the straight wall having only the main body wall, that is, the soundproofing effect of the embodiment A is higher than that of the comparative example, and the embodiment in which the re-branching walls 8 and 9 are provided as compared with the embodiment A. Example B
It can be seen that the soundproofing effect is higher for. The numerical values in Table 1 indicate the sound reduction (dB) with respect to the comparative example.

In general, the smaller the sound pressure level at the diffraction point of a sound, the weaker the diffraction sound. In the embodiment B, as shown in FIG. 11, at the tip of the re-branch wall 9 re-branched from the second branch wall 3 on the opposite side to the sound source, the sound wave a circulating from the sound source is reflected by the second branch wall 3. At a certain frequency, the sound pressure level becomes extremely low due to interference with the generated sound wave b, and the final diffraction sound is drastically reduced. Further, as shown in FIG. 12, it is considered that the energy flow becomes a vortex at a certain frequency from the sound receiving point side to the sound source side, and a noise reduction effect is produced.
